States doing the most for a clean energy future

If the pace of greenhouse gas emissions continues, climate change will endanger people around the world. Within the U.S., wildfires will become larger and more frequent, storms and sea-level rise will transform coasts, and farmers will struggle to grow crops during intense heat waves. Some of these changes have already begun.

While the U.S. faces many of climate change’s biggest threats, it’s also uniquely positioned to do something about it—the U.S. Department of Energy reports that the country emits more carbon dioxide than every other country except China. For many state lawmakers, this is a call to arms. They’ve begun to lower their states’ emissions and infuse their grids with renewable energy. Others have been slow to change. Political disagreements, fear of cost, and other pressing policy issues can take precedence over ensuring a clean energy future.

In order to rank all 50 states and D.C. by their efforts to run on clean energy, Stacker consulted data from the American Council for an Energy-Efficient Economy (ACEEE) 2018 State Energy Scorecard. ACEEE ranked the states on their local policies in six areas: state government, utilities, transportation, heat and power, building energy efficiency, and appliance standards.

Many states incorporated cleaner energy across the board, despite working under a federal government that has been moving policy in the opposite direction. The Trump Administration has taken steps to roll back federal car emissions standards, for example; meanwhile, states like California have pushed back and implemented or strengthened their own standards. Many states have improved their energy efficiency. Others have built new systems to capture renewable energy, like Rhode Island when it built the nation’s first offshore wind farm.

Every state has room to cut back on its energy waste and transition to renewables—even Massachusetts, the highest-ranking state, which still uses more energy per capita than other states.

#51. Wyoming

- Overall score: 4.5 (out of 50 points)
- State government score: 2 (out of 5; 1.5 points below national median)
- Buildings score: 0 (out of 8; 5 points below national median)
- Combined heat and power score: 0 (out of 4; 1.5 points below national median)
- Utilities score: 1 (out of 20; 4 points below national median)
- Transportation score: 1.5 (out of 10; 1.5 points below national median)
- Appliance standards score: 0 (out of 3; 0 points below national median)

Wyoming is the epitome of coal country. As the nation’s top coal producer, the state’s transition to renewable energy would mean a dramatic change in the way of life for its citizens. Wyoming lawmakers are preventing such a change through laws like the recently passed Senate File 159, which incentivizes coal fire plant owners and potential buyers to keep these plants up and running.

#49. North Dakota (tie)

- Overall score: 5.5 (out of 50 points)
- State government score: 0.5 (out of 5; 3 points below national median)
- Buildings score: 3 (out of 8; 2 points below national median)
- Combined heat and power score: 0.5 (out of 4; 1 points below national median)
- Utilities score: 0 (out of 20; 5 points below national median)
- Transportation score: 1.5 (out of 10; 1.5 points below national median)
- Appliance standards score: 0 (out of 3; 0 points below national median)

The Dakota Access Pipeline, which moves 570,000 barrels of petroleum per day, became famous when protesters on Standing Rock Sioux reservation tried to halt its construction in 2016. This pipeline is just a small part of the state’s petroleum boom: During the past decade, North Dakota has multiplied its petroleum production by more than six times. Not only does the state’s economy rely heavily on this non-renewable energy—the state’s utilities don’t spend any money on electricity efficiency programs, accounting for its low ranking.

Indiana had been slowly but steadily improving its energy portfolio until 2014. That’s when then-Gov. Mike Pence ended the key initiative, Energizing Indiana—a series of programs that the Indiana Utility Regulatory Commission determined had saved the state energy and money.

In 2018, the District of Columbia passed legislation for a Green Bank—a pot of public money used to draw private funders to clean energy projects in the district. For instance, the money can be loaned to a company to retrofit buildings with solar panels. With state funding backing projects, the hope is that investors will add some of their own money to the projects, viewing them as less risky.

Vermont pioneered an energy-saving program called an Energy Efficiency Utility (EEU) in the year 1999. The program, called Efficiency Vermont, pulls money from utility bills across the state and uses it for energy-saving projects. Since the start of Vermont’s EEU, the state has continued to pass clean energy policy. It recently increased energy standards for appliances—a step that relatively few states have taken.
